:root{--bg:#0f1724;--panel:#0b1220;--accent:#0b71ff;--muted:#94a3b8;--glass: rgba(255,255,255,.04);--nav-bg: #ffffff;--nav-text: #0f1724}*{box-sizing:border-box}html,body{height:100%;margin:0;padding:0;font-family:Inter,ui-sans-serif,system-ui,Segoe UI,Roboto,Helvetica,Arial}body{background:linear-gradient(180deg,#07102a,#071428 50%);color:#e6eef8;padding-top:80px}.navbar.modern{display:flex;align-items:center;justify-content:space-between;padding:12px 28px;background:var(--nav-bg);-webkit-backdrop-filter:blur(6px);backdrop-filter:blur(6px);border-bottom:1px solid rgba(15,23,36,.06);box-shadow:0 6px 20px #0f17240a;position:fixed;top:0;left:0;right:0;z-index:1000}.brand .brand-link{font-weight:700;color:var(--nav-text);text-decoration:none;font-size:1.05rem;display:flex;align-items:center;gap:10px}.brand .accent{color:var(--accent);margin-left:4px}.brand img.logo{height:50px;width:auto;display:block}.brand .brand-text{font-weight:700;font-size:1.2rem}.nav-links{display:flex;gap:12px;align-items:center}.nav-links a{color:var(--nav-text);text-decoration:none;padding:8px 10px;border-radius:6px;transition:all .12s}.nav-links a:hover{background:#0206170a;transform:translateY(-1px)}.nav-actions{display:flex;gap:10px;align-items:center}.btn{background:linear-gradient(90deg,var(--accent),#60a5fa);color:#fff;padding:8px 12px;border-radius:8px;text-decoration:none;font-weight:600}.btn-ghost{background:transparent;border:1px solid rgba(15,23,36,.06);color:var(--nav-text);padding:7px 12px;border-radius:8px}.btn-link{background:none;border:none;color:var(--nav-text);cursor:pointer}.dropdown{position:relative}.dropbtn{background:transparent;border:none;color:var(--nav-text);padding:8px 10px;border-radius:6px;cursor:pointer}.dropdown-content{position:absolute;top:calc(100% + 8px);left:0;min-width:220px;background:var(--nav-bg);border-radius:10px;padding:6px 0;box-shadow:0 10px 30px #02061714;opacity:0;pointer-events:none;transform:translateY(-6px);transition:all .15s}.dropdown-content.open{opacity:1;pointer-events:auto;transform:translateY(0)}.dropdown-content a{display:block;padding:10px 14px;color:var(--nav-text);text-decoration:none}.dropdown-content a:hover{background:#0206170a;color:var(--nav-text)}.dropbtn.active-link{background:var(--accent);color:#fff}.active-link,.nav-links a.active-link{background:var(--accent);color:#fff;padding:8px 10px;border-radius:6px}.dropdown-content a.active-link{background:#0b71ff1f;color:var(--nav-text)}.members-row{display:grid;gap:24px;margin-bottom:24px}.top-row{grid-template-columns:1fr;justify-items:center}.second-row{grid-template-columns:repeat(2,1fr)}.third-row{grid-template-columns:repeat(4,1fr)}.member-card{background:var(--panel);padding:20px;border-radius:12px;text-align:center;color:#dbeafe;box-shadow:0 8px 30px #02061799;transition:transform .3s ease,box-shadow .3s ease;overflow:hidden}.member-card:hover{transform:translateY(-8px);box-shadow:0 16px 50px #020617cc}.member-card img{width:100%;height:220px;object-fit:contain;border-radius:10px;margin-bottom:12px;transition:transform .3s ease}.member-card img:hover{transform:scale(1.05)}.member-card h4{margin:8px 0;font-size:1.2rem;font-weight:600}.member-card p{margin:4px 0;color:var(--muted);font-size:.95rem}.members-page{padding-top:40px;max-width:1200px;margin:0 auto}@media (max-width: 768px){.members-row{grid-template-columns:repeat(auto-fit,minmax(200px,1fr));gap:16px;margin-bottom:16px}.top-row{justify-items:stretch}.member-card{padding:16px}.member-card img{height:180px}.members-page{padding-top:20px}}.admin-wrap{display:flex;gap:18px}.admin-sidebar{width:220px;background:#fff;padding:18px;border-radius:8px;color:#0f1724}.admin-brand{font-weight:700;margin-bottom:6px}.admin-user{color:#475569;margin-bottom:12px}.admin-nav{display:flex;flex-direction:column;gap:8px}.admin-nav a{color:#0f1724;text-decoration:none;padding:8px;border-radius:6px}.admin-nav a.active{background:var(--accent);color:#fff}.admin-main{flex:1;padding:18px;background:transparent}.users-table{width:100%;border-collapse:collapse}.users-table th,.users-table td{padding:8px;border-bottom:1px solid rgba(15,23,36,.06);text-align:left}.users-table select{padding:6px}.container{padding:24px}.app-grid{display:flex;gap:18px}.app-grid>.container{flex:1}.hero{padding:64px 20px;background:linear-gradient(180deg,transparent,rgba(255,255,255,.01));display:flex;align-items:center;justify-content:center}.hero-inner{max-width:920px;text-align:center}.hero h1{font-size:2.6rem;margin:0 0 12px;color:#fff}.hero .lead{color:var(--muted);font-size:1.05rem;margin-bottom:18px}.hero-cta .btn{margin-right:12px}.showcase{position:relative;height:420px;pointer-events:none}.float-grid{position:relative;width:100%;height:100%;max-width:1200px;margin:0 auto}.float-item{position:absolute;width:280px;height:180px;border-radius:14px;overflow:hidden;box-shadow:0 20px 50px #03081799;border:1px solid rgba(255,255,255,.04);background:linear-gradient(180deg,rgba(255,255,255,.02),transparent)}.float-item img{width:100%;height:100%;object-fit:cover;display:block}.float-item.f1{left:6%;top:8%;animation:floatA 6s ease-in-out infinite}.float-item.f2{right:10%;top:14%;width:300px;height:200px;animation:floatB 7s ease-in-out infinite}.float-item.f3{left:22%;bottom:8%;width:260px;height:170px;animation:floatC 5.5s ease-in-out infinite}.float-item.f4{right:26%;bottom:10%;width:300px;height:200px;animation:floatD 8s ease-in-out infinite}@keyframes floatA{0%{transform:translateY(0) rotate(-1deg)}50%{transform:translateY(-14px) rotate(1deg)}to{transform:translateY(0) rotate(-1deg)}}@keyframes floatB{0%{transform:translateY(0) rotate(2deg)}50%{transform:translateY(-20px) rotate(-1deg)}to{transform:translateY(0) rotate(2deg)}}@keyframes floatC{0%{transform:translateY(0) rotate(-2deg)}50%{transform:translateY(-12px) rotate(2deg)}to{transform:translateY(0) rotate(-2deg)}}@keyframes floatD{0%{transform:translateY(0) rotate(1deg)}50%{transform:translateY(-16px) rotate(-1deg)}to{transform:translateY(0) rotate(1deg)}}.about{max-width:900px;margin:44px auto;padding:0 18px}.about h2{color:#fff}.about p{color:var(--muted);line-height:1.6}.form{max-width:420px}.form input{width:100%;padding:10px;margin-bottom:8px;border-radius:8px;border:1px solid rgba(255,255,255,.04);background:#061027;color:#e6eef8}.auth-page{display:flex;align-items:center;justify-content:center;min-height:calc(100vh - 80px);padding:24px}.auth-card{width:100%;max-width:520px;background:#fff;color:#0f1724;padding:28px;border-radius:12px;box-shadow:0 20px 60px #02061759;border:1px solid rgba(2,6,23,.06)}.auth-brand{text-align:center;margin-bottom:8px}.auth-title{margin:8px 0 18px;text-align:center;color:#0f1724}.auth-form .form input{background:#f8fafc;color:#0f1724;border:1px solid rgba(15,23,36,.06)}.auth-form .btn{width:100%;padding:10px;border-radius:10px}.auth-card small a{color:var(--accent);text-decoration:none}.error{color:#ff7b7b}@media (max-width:600px){.float-item{display:none}.hero h1{font-size:1.8rem}.nav-links{display:none}}
